DIY Hand Sanitizer

I don't like hand sanitizer.  It leaves a weird film sometimes, it dries my skin, and I really don't want my body absorbing tons of chemicals.  I prefer good ole non-antibacterial soap under warm water for about thirty seconds.  I know, I know, not the typical mom.  In a pinch I will succumb if I am desperate-- think porta potty.  EEKKK!

Aloe Vera Plants


Here is a recipe for a homemade sanitizer that I do love. Just four simple ingredients.

  • Aloe Vera Gel
  • Witch Hazel
  • Vitamin E Capsule
  • Lavender Essential Oil  (I use lemon or peppermint essential oil because the hubs is very sensitive to smells and lavender is a no-no in our house. )
